We all know that car theft in Nigeria is a serious menace that really needs to be curbed, most especially in this festive season were every one wants to make it big and live large during the yuletide. For this reason, Stolencars, a car theft reporting site, were users can easily report their stolen cars any where in Nigeria for free was developed to try check the incessant car theft occurrence in Nigeria, and save second hand car buyers the embarrassment and wahala from police, associated with buying stolen cars. Here is how it works; 1. Register your stolen car on the platform. 2. Get searched by that car buyer who uses stolen cars to verify car theft status before purchase 3. Swiftly get notification by email when your car pops up. There is also a VIN decode service to decode your car VIN for vehicle information. Check it out! How does one prove that a car being reported has actually been stolen? How do you as the developer verify this proof? Lofty idea but I think you need to go back and rethink the entire way it should operate. Kudos |

Currently there is indeed no way to verify if the car been reported is truly stolen. although we do not carry out any form of investigation, i do align with you that there should be a way to actually verify this claim. In the next update, we will look into putting medium in place to allow the user provide a link to a publication declaring the car stolen, or upload a report from a law enforcement agency, backing this claim before the report can approved. |
